5. Troubleshooting Common Deposit Issues
From declined payments to delayed credits, deposit errors can quickly sour an otherwise enjoyable gaming session. This section lists frequent obstacles and actionable solutions.
5.1. Declined or Stopped Payments
Reasons can include insufficient funds, blocked merchant codes, or regional restrictions. Contact your bank or card issuer immediately.
5.2. Pending Transaction Status
Some banks or e‑wallets perform anti‑fraud checks that may take 24‑48 hours. Contact the casino’s support for expedited processing.
5.3. Mismatched Transaction Amount
If the credited amount does not match your intended deposit, ensure no service fees were deducted. Verify your account balance and dispute with your provider if necessary.

Can I set a deposit limit or budget?
Yes, many online casinos provide account‑level controls that let players set daily, weekly, or monthly deposit limits. These features help manage spending and promote responsible gaming. You can also set self‑exclusion or time‑out controls if you feel you need additional safeguards.
How long does a bank transfer typically take to process?
Bank transfers can take anywhere from 3 to 7 business days, depending on both the sending and receiving banks’ processing times and any intermediary financial institutions involved. Some casinos offer accelerated bank transfer options with slightly higher fees.
What should I do if my deposit is pending for over 24 hours?
First, verify the transaction status in your banking or e‑wallet account. If it remains pending, contact the casino’s customer support with your transaction ID. Most issues are resolved within 48 hours once the support team confirms the deposit with your financial provider.
